Output 58d83c0fed5e2504e6637cfde3dddd6ad5ddf6510e5a60d836f07585ae808fc2:0

value
51976
script pubkey
OP_0 OP_PUSHBYTES_32 58d277aa3070be8f2e81230a7bf59ee5b5bca8e53a7a33bc474d9eef28397584
address
bc1qtrf8023swzlg7t5pyv98hav7uk6me2898far80z8fk0w72pewkzqtpwrec
transaction
58d83c0fed5e2504e6637cfde3dddd6ad5ddf6510e5a60d836f07585ae808fc2
spent
true